"This is a football player. And if you go to New York to play for Tom Coughlin, you better be nothing less. Great pick by the Giants." -- Mike Mayock

“There are certain players that you evaluate as you go through the process that despite differences of what you think of his speed or toughness, you come away saying, ‘This guy is a good football player,’ ” said Marc Ross, the Giants’ director of college scouting. “There’s only a handful of those guys in the draft every year, and this was one of those players.”

Wilson has been mocked to NYG a bit at 32, I just think people had trouble fitting all the players they like into the first round so dropped RBs (they do tend to drop).

A lot of people have Wilson as the 2nd best back behind Richardson.

David Wilson actually reminds me a lot of Tiki Barber with his very similar size, deceptive strength/power, break away speed, home run threat, good hands, return kicks etc.
You know our coaching staff how to effectvely use that style of RB.
